Recipe Information

Ingredients

For:
8
serving(s)

Ingredients A (Sifted once)

  • 250 g self-rising flour
  • 3 tsp baking powder
  • 1/8 tsp salt

Ingredients B

  • 50 g caster sugar
  • 120 g cold butter, cubed

Ingredients C

  • 150 ml sour cream

Ingredients D

  • milk, for brushing

Directions

  1. Combine Ingredients A and B in a bowl. Rub together with your hands until the mixture resembles breadcrumbs.
  2. Make a well in the center of the mixture, then add the sour cream. Mix.
  3. Flatten the mixture and press into a round mold.
  4. Brush the surface of the scone with milk.
  5. Bake at 200°C for 9 minutes.
